Heimann Sensor develops thermopile arrays for AAL tools with data protection in mind

Photo by Heimann Sensor GmbH

An increasing number of people in need for care are dependent on one of the Ambient Assisted Living (short AAL) tools available on the market. The reason is their wish for independency and security while living in a single household. Simultaneously, the protection of their personal data has become more relevant.

Heimann Sensor can provide the necessary high-quality thermopile arrays for customers’ AAL systems that enable continued independence while securing data protection. For example, Heimann Sensor’s infrared thermopile array HTPA 32x32d, integrated into warning system, can detect the falling person and ensure fast medical aid. Moreover, the HTPA 32×32 L2.1 or L2.5 provide the sufficient resolution and adequate field of view, while the identification of the person remains impossible.
